I just purchased (12-22-21) the Space Shuttle sim for FSX and even though I am using the correct order no., e-mail etc. it is NOT allowing me to install the product. The issue is NOT firewall related and I have tried ALL suggested ideas. I am running FSX and have been for years and have no problems with installations. Short of asking for a refund I would like to install it.....any suggestions?

Add the location (folder) where you downloaded the installer to, the folder where FSX is installed, and possibly even the file itself (css001_1100.exe), to your AV exclusions list.
Then. Right click on the installer and select "Run as administrator" from the list.
See if that helps you get it installed.
